The coolant tank, also known as the coolant overflow bottle, is designed to hold coolant when the fluid heats up. Most vehicles have markings on the coolant overflow tank or reservoir that identify the proper level. To fix the problem, remove the excess fluid or repair the broken part. If your coolant reservoir is overflowing, it could be due to too much fluid in the system or a failure of a critical component.
